To help better understand gay men’s sexual self-labels
This research study is for all the gay science geeks out there! The manuscript is as long and detailed as the title indicates. It was submitted to and published by PMC for the National Center for Biotechnology Information (NCBI), US National Library of Medicine (NLM), National Institutes of Health (NIH).
The journal publication details research by David A. Moskowitz and Trevor A. Hart who studied gay and bisexual men and the self labels they assign to themselves regarding their anal penetrative role (i.e., bottom or exclusively receptive; top or exclusively insertive; or versatile, both receptive and insertive during anal intercourse).
The goal of the research was to help better understand gay men’s sexual self-labels.
